The decribtion belonging to the episode: "It was the wrong day for a picnic! Mitch and Ryan head for the oil rig abandoned after a strange accident and spot a drifting yacht. Searching it they find a terrified young woman who says her host was pulled off the yacht by a weird sea monster. They have to abandon the yacht and use a rubber life raft to reach the oil rig where the gelatinous green stuff catches them."
